There are three reasons for the recent surge in this keyword: Old PDFs circulating on forums (dating back to 2005) were terrible. They were blurry, tilted, and missing pages. The "new" refers to community-remastered versions —high-contrast, 300 DPI scans that are printable and tablet-friendly. These often include bookmarks for each of the 60+ lessons. 2. The Ritmico App Integration While not a PDF, several music education apps have released "Pozzoli Engines" that randomize his exercises. Users searching for a PDF often stumble upon these new interactive tools, then search for the original static PDF to use offline. 3. Re-notation in Modern Engraving A truly "new" version of the Solfeo Hablado exists as a re-typeset document. Musicians using software like MuseScore or LilyPond have transcribed Pozzoli’s exercises into sleek, modern notation (similar to the New Bach Edition style). These new engravings are easier to read and frequently updated for errata. How to Identify a High-Quality "New" Pozzoli PDF Not all PDFs are created equal.
